Officers are asking for the public’s assistance in tracing a missing man from the Thornwood area of Glasgow.

Michael Sheldon was last seen at an address in Thornwood Drive at around 6.50am on Tuesday, 21 March, 2023 and enquiries have identified him getting off a train at Perth Railway station at 1.07pm later that day.

The 39-year-old is believed to have left the station on foot and has not been seen since.

He has links to the Perth area and the west end of Glasgow.

Michael is described as 5ft 11ins tall, with brown hair and brown eyes. He is believed to be wearing a checked shirt, green and black jacket, dark-coloured walking boots and trousers, and carrying a rucksack (as pictured).

Sergeant Eric McNaught said: “This behaviour is unlike Michael and we are eager to trace him as soon as possible.

“I’d ask anyone who has seen him, or a man matching his description, to report any sighting to officers so that we can investigate.

“I would ask anyone with dash cam or private CCTV systems from the area where Michael was last seen to check their systems and provide any relevant footage to us as soon as possible so we can piece together his movements from Perth railway station.”

Those with information should contact Police Scotland via 101 and quote incident number 3346 of 21 March 2023.

Police have now confirmed a body they believe to be Michael's was found by officers in Bridge of Earn, Perthshire, at around 12.50pm on Saturday.

Michael's family have been informed.
